To fill out a conservation potential assessment, follow these steps:
02
Start by gathering all relevant information, such as historical data, geographic information, and current conservation efforts.
03
Identify the conservation goals or objectives that the assessment aims to achieve.
04
Evaluate the current state of the environment or target area. This may involve analyzing ecological data, assessing threats and risks, and understanding the baseline conditions.
05
Identify potential conservation measures or actions that can contribute to the desired goals. These could include habitat restoration, species protection, sustainable resource management, or policy development.
06
Assess the feasibility and effectiveness of each conservation measure. Consider factors such as cost, technological readiness, legal and policy constraints, stakeholder involvement, and potential impacts.
07
Prioritize the conservation measures based on their potential impact, feasibility, and alignment with the conservation goals.
08
Develop a detailed action plan for implementing the chosen conservation measures. Include timelines, responsibilities, resource allocation, and monitoring strategies.
09
Regularly evaluate and review the progress of the conservation efforts, making adjustments as needed.
10
Continuously monitor and assess the conservation outcomes to measure the effectiveness of the implemented measures.
11
Document the findings, actions, and results of the conservation potential assessment for future reference and learning.
12
Remember to involve relevant stakeholders, such as scientists, conservation practitioners, policymakers, local communities, and experts, throughout the assessment process.
